The Problem
Fluctuating demand and diverse GPU needs created resource inefficiencies.
InstaHeadshots is revolutionizing professional photography by transforming casual selfies into studio-quality headshots within minutes. Their AI-driven platform caters to professionals seeking polished images for LinkedIn, resumes, and social media profiles, eliminating the need for traditional photoshoots.
As InstaHeadshots experienced rapid growth, they faced two significant challenges:
- Fluctuating Demand: User activity varied greatly, with peak times requiring substantial GPU resources and off-peak periods leaving expensive hardware underutilized.
- Diverse Workloads: Their AI models needed a range of GPU types — some demanding high performance for complex tasks, others requiring efficiency for lighter processes.
Traditional cloud providers couldn't offer the flexibility or cost-effectiveness needed to address these issues.
The Solution
Serverless GPU architecture with auto-scaling and diverse hardware options.
In search of a more adaptable solution, Insta Headshots turned to Runpod. The transition was seamless, with one engineer migrating all production workloads in a single day.
"Surprisingly, the process of migrating to Runpod was extremely easy and seamless."
— Bharat, Co-founder of InstaHeadshots
Runpod's serverless architecture allowed InstaHeadshots to:
- Auto-Scale Resources: Dynamically adjust GPU usage in real-time, aligning with user demand without manual intervention.
- Access Diverse GPU Types: Select the most appropriate hardware for each task, optimizing performance and cost.
- Reduce Costs: Pay only for the compute power used, eliminating expenses from idle resources.
The Results
50% cost reduction and 100% performance improvement.
Post-migration, InstaHeadshots reported:
- 50% Reduction in GPU Costs: Efficient resource utilization led to substantial savings.
- 100% Improvement in Performance: Faster processing times enhanced user experience.
"Runpod has allowed us to focus entirely on growth and product development without us having to worry about the GPU infrastructure at all."
— Bharat, Co-founder of InstaHeadshots
Conclusion
Instant Clusters enable foundational model development without commitments.
With plans to develop their own foundational models for image generation, InstaHeadshots is exploring Runpod's Instant Clusters for on-demand access to high-performance GPU clusters, supporting their continued innovation without long-term commitments.
"We're excited to try Runpod's Instant Clusters because it gives us instant access to high-performing GPU clusters with no long-term commitments."
— Bharat, Co-founder of InstaHeadshots
Summary:
- 50% reduction in GPU costs
- 100% improvement in performance
- Seamless migration completed in one day
- Scalable infrastructure supporting rapid growth and innovation
Runpod's flexible and efficient GPU infrastructure has empowered InstaHeadshots to scale effectively, optimize costs, and focus on delivering exceptional AI-generated portraits to their users.
Go experiment with InstaHeadshots and update your profile pics now!